Car
If you are driving from central St. Augustine, head south on US-1 S. After about 2 miles, take the exit toward FL-312 E. Merge onto FL-312 E and continue for approximately 2 miles. You will then merge onto A1A S (Coastal Highway). Continue on A1A S for about 4 miles until you reach the entrance for Anastasia State Park on your left at 300 Anastasia Park Rd. There is a parking fee of $2 per vehicle for entry.
Public Transportation
If you are using public transportation, take the St. Augustine Public Transit system. Board the 'Red Line' bus towards A1A Beach, which operates on weekdays. Check the bus schedule for the exact times. Once you reach the stop closest to the park, you will need to walk approximately 1 mile to the park entrance at 300 Anastasia Park Rd. It's advisable to wear comfortable shoes as the walk can be along the roadside.
Bicycle
For those who prefer biking, you can rent a bike from one of the local shops in St. Augustine. Take the scenic route along A1A S, which is bike-friendly. The distance from downtown St. Augustine to Anastasia State Park is about 4 miles. Ensure you wear a helmet and follow all traffic rules. The park has bike racks for you to secure your bike while you explore.
